Teljes leírás

Lasun was a young African boy that found himself in the situation of dilemma. He had responsibility which he believed was beyond his age. On the visitation of a missionary family to Aruna community, Lasun was in a position to have a hand in the execution of those missionaries. But his mind was against this; he wished to save them. He eventually succeeded partially, and this made him become intimate with the white girl Roselyn. With the help of Tunga and Mata, Lasun was able to preserve the life of the white girl. This success in the long run launched Lasun into the world of African affairs in the Town. This was where he met the Black Boys and Black's Master. It was a war between the nationalists and the colonial government and Lasun found himself standing in the middle of the crisis. He felt so honoured to be in a position to contribute to the development of the state. His experience with Master Chima was awesome, and this bred another belief in him about Africa.
